Is CapCut Pro APK Safe Or Dangerous?
Short answer?
Usually risky.
The question Is Capcut Pro Apk Safe appears constantly because users want premium features for free. Unfortunately, unofficial modified APK files create the biggest security danger around CapCut right now.
Hidden risks many users ignore
Modified APK files change the original application code. Once altered, users can no longer verify:
- who edited the file
- what permissions were added
- whether trackers exist
- if malware was injected
Some cracked APKs behave normally for weeks before problems appear. That delayed behavior makes detection difficult.
During testing reported by Android communities, certain modded editing apps quietly consumed excessive battery power and background data usage even when not actively opened.
That’s usually not a good sign.
Why cracked apps become security problems
Hackers know people search for premium unlocked apps constantly. That demand creates easy opportunities for malware distribution.
Some APK sites inject:
- advertising frameworks
- spyware
- hidden browser redirects
- cryptocurrency mining scripts
Users searching Is Capcut Pro Safe often assume all “Pro” versions are official premium releases. Many are actually modified copies uploaded by anonymous developers.
That changes the risk completely.
What Information Does CapCut Collect?
This is probably the part many users care about most.
CapCut collects certain information similar to many modern editing and social media platforms. According to privacy disclosures, data may include:
- device identifiers
- crash reports
- usage analytics
- uploaded media
- account details
At first glance, that sounds alarming. In reality, many popular apps collect similar data.
Permissions that confuse users
A lot of people see permission requests and immediately assume spyware exists. Sometimes those permissions are simply required for editing features to function properly.
Examples:
- storage access imports clips
- microphone access records audio
- camera access creates videos directly inside the app
Still, users should always review permissions manually after installation. Some permissions remain enabled longer than necessary.
That’s probably why privacy-conscious users prefer limiting app access where possible.

Ways To Use CapCut More Safely
Using CapCut safely mostly depends on where you download it from and how carefully you handle app permissions.
Smart download habits
Safer installation practices include:
- Download only from trusted stores
- Avoid “premium unlocked” APK sites
- Keep device security updates enabled
- Review app permissions manually
- Scan APK files before installing
People often ignore these simple steps until something suspicious happens.
Security checks before installing APKs
Before installing any APK:
- check user reviews
- verify file size consistency
- avoid excessive permission requests
- scan files through antivirus tools
Some fake APK sites purposely fill pages with several “Download” buttons so users accidentally install completely different apps instead of the real file.

Common Warning Signs Of Unsafe APK Files
Certain warning signs appear repeatedly with suspicious APK downloads:
- random browser redirects
- overheating devices
- excessive battery drain
- unexpected notification spam
- background ads
- hidden app installations
Not every device problem automatically means something harmful is installed. Still, multiple suspicious symptoms together should not be ignored.
